编程界的小学生
基于Elasticsearch7.6.2的安装
一、Elasticsearch的安装
1、Windows
1.1、安装jdk
安装JDK,至少1.8.0以上版本,java -version
1.2、下载ES
下载和解压缩Elasticsearch7.6.2
1.3、启动ES
ES就是简单粗暴,开箱即用。直接双击.bat文件即可。
1.4、验证ES
1.4.1、log
1.4.2、验证
在config/elasticsearch.yml文件里的
cluster.name(默认elasticsearch)和node.name这两个配置。
二、Kibana的安装
1、下载Kibana
下载和解压缩Kibana7.6.2
2、启动
3、验证
3.1、log
3.2、验证
4、补充
我们写es语法都会在DevTools菜单里写。如下查看集群健康状态。
三、Head插件的安装
1、下载
https://github.com/mobz/elasticsearch-head
2、安装
2.1、安装node
2.2、编译head
(1)切换到elasticsearch-head路径
(2)npm install -g cnpm --registry=https://registry.npm.taobao.org
(3)cnpm i
2.3、配置
更改端口:修改elasticsearch-head下Gruntfile.js文件,默认监听在127.0.0.1下9100端口
2.4、启动
npm run start
3、验证
3.1、log
3.2、验证
3.3、疑难杂症
如果访问网址http://localhost:9100/出现如上的情况,连接不上es。如下解决
在es配置文件里(elasticsearch.yml
),添加如下两行
http.cors.enabled: true
http.cors.allow-origin: "*"
然后重启ES、重启head插件即可。
微信公众号